The pan tilt head is one of the most common types of camera head used in broadcast studios. This type of head is usually mounted on a studio pedestal or tripod, and it can be controlled remotely by a cameraman or technician using a joystick. The important thing to remember about pan tilt heads is that they have two axes of motion: both pan and tilt. The operator can set the framing by either moving the head on the pan axis, or by adjusting it in relation to its base on the tilt axis.
